CareRx is looking for a Clinical Consultant Pharmacist to join our Kelownateam. The Clinical Consultant Pharmacist is responsible for maintaining continuity of care for clientele through collaboration between onsite physicians, nursing staff, and other health providers at long term care, supportive living, and other congregate living communities.The Clinical Consultant Pharmacist is responsible for completing clinical pharmacy activities in alignment with the Continuing Care Health Service Standards, site policies, internal CareRx policies, and the Ministerial Order for Clinical Pharmacy Services.

Role Accountabilities:

  • Act as aliaisonbetweenlong term care homesand retirement communitiesand CareRx Pharmacyto ensure optimal Resident care, Pharmacy Services, and Clinical support
  • Travel to LTC homes and retirement communities
  • Build and maintain relationships within the community to ensure ongoing collaboration and communication between home/communityleadership teams and pharmacy teams to develop/maintain strong partnerships
  • Complete medication reviews in currently serviced retirementcommunities and long-term care homesserviced by CareRx Pharmacy
  • Complete all required documentation and billing processes as required by MOHLTC, College of Pharmacists of British Columbia and other federal and provincial standards and regulations
  • Provide education to Residents and staff on various health-related topics including theMeds Checkprogram and attend community-based wellness fairsand other eventsas required
  • Conducteducation sessions withinLong Term Care Homes and Retirement Communities withinscope of practice, as applicable (e.g. policy and procedure, web portal,eMAR, influenza protocol, etc.)
  • Support CareRx Pharmacy policies and procedures within retirementcommunities and long-term care homes
  • Completemedication audits on-site in LTC Homes and Retirement Communitiesas required
  • Ensure regular on-site visits are made to all assigned clients
  • Attend/participate in annual professional conferences and trade shows, when applicable
  • Participate in the development and implementation of industry-leading clinical pharmacy service, when applicable
  • Be an education, policy and pharmacy initiative resource
  • Be available for special clinical team projects as required
  • Complete/collaborate in the develop of medication audit follow-up improvement plans when applicable
  • Works collaboratively with other team members to support applicable homes and communities
  • Participate in pharmacy-related transition processes (e.g., new client transitions, eMAR transitions, etc.)
  • Help with pharmacy operations/drug distribution when required
  • Attend and actively participate in clinical team meetings
